THEY'VE headlined Glastonbury, V Festival and the Isle of Wight Festival and now they’re coming to Bournemouth beach!

Travis will perform at Bournemouth Air Festival this summer, one of the acts to take to the Wave 105 Night Air stage this August.

The band will play the Friday August 19 family pop night Hits on the Beach. Currently celebrating their 20th anniversary, Travis are one of Britain’s most successful bands of the past few decades, clocking up 18 Top 40 hits and 8 albums, two of which won Best British Album at the Brit Awards. One of these, The Man Who, went nine times platinum selling over three million copies in the UK alone and making it one of the biggest selling albums ever.

Dance music returns to Night Air At The Piers for the second year running the following night under a new name Sunsets On The Beach - The Official Air Festival Beach Party. Wave 105 has teamed up with Halo to present headliners Example and DJ Wire, with support from club and chart stars Blonde, plus DJ’s Jaguar Skills and Majestic - a line up guaranteed to get the crowd dancing on the sand against the backdrop of the setting sun over Boscombe beach.

Proms on the Beach, hosted by Wave 105’s Kate Weston, returns to Night Air on Thursday August 18. The Band of Her Majesty’s Royal Marines Collingwood return for a very British affair by the water’s edge.

Wave 105’s programme of Bournemouth Air Festival Night Air At The Piers entertainment is sponsored by Shorefield Holiday Parks, and will run across three nights offering a range of music to suit all tastes and ages, supported by stunning night flying displays.

Keith Penny, Wave 105 Event Director, said: “Wave 105’s Night Air concerts are now a staple part of the events calendar in Bournemouth. The Air Festival’s stunning illuminated night flying displays over the bay, combined with top class music on the beach, is a unique experience that the public and artists really enjoy in equal measure."

Crowned last year’s Visit England’s Tourism Event of the Year, the 2016 Air Festival will host thrilling demonstrations from leading aviation groups, including the Red Arrows, RN Black Cats Helicopter Display Team and Tigers Freefall Parachute Display Team. Only displaying at Bournemouth and one other this year, the Super Puma Display Team has just been announced as a new addition to the 2016 show.
